  • The first thing that stands out to me on this slate is the need to fit two centers into your lineup on Draftkings.  Specifically, players who are only eligible at the center position that project for a great value.  Some examples of players I’m looking to combine in lineups include
    • Karl Anthony Towns
    • Joel Embiid
    • Andre Drummond
    • Rudy Gobert
    • Myles Turner
    • Nikola Vucevic
    • Hassan Whiteside
    • Clint Capea
  • All the centers listed above project as positive values on this slate and will all be included in my player pool tonight.  Something to think about when making a GPP lineup or entering a top-heavy contest…. ownership does matter.  With players that are only single-position eligible on Draftkings you dramatically decrease the dupes you’ll see of this two player combo by using your UTIL spot on a center.  Something to think about when entering tonight.
  • The top play on the slate is KAT so this should be very easy to do given that KAT will be in a lot of your lineups to start off with.
  • I’m likely going with a 2 stud approach (Kat and either Harden/Giannis) in my single entry/3-max GPPs today and pairing them with a mid-high tier center as stated above.

  • Next, I am going to be focused on exposing myself to high total games with tight spreads when stacking in GPPs.
    • One of the most underrated parts of NBA DFS is game stacking.  The amount of times game stacks are utilized compared to the number of overtimes we see in the NBA is extremely underutilized.
    • When playing the 50,000 person GPP’s, you should be picking a game that you think will be competitive with a chance to go to overtime.  We gain a ton of additional value when a game goes to overtime and we have the relevant DFS plays from that game stacked up.
